This is a draft item of legislation. This draft has since been made as a Scottish Statutory Instrument: The Adoption (Disclosure of Information and Medical Information about Natural Parents) (Scotland) Regulations 2009 No. 268
6. An adoption agency must provide such access to its case records and the indexes to them and disclose such information in its possession, as may be required, to–
(a)those holding an inquiry under section 6A of the Social Work (Scotland) Act 1968(1) (inquiries), or under the Inquiries Act 2005(2), for the purposes of such an inquiry;
(b)the Scottish Ministers;
(c)the Scottish Public Services Ombudsman;
(d)the Scottish Commission for the Regulation of Care;
(e)the persons and authorities referred to in regulations 14 (notification of adoption agency decisions) and 24 (placement for adoption: notification and provision of information) of the 2009 Regulations, to the extent specified in those regulations;
(f)a court having power to make an Order under the Act or under the Children (Scotland) Act 1995(3); and
(g)a curator ad litem or reporting officer appointed under rules made pursuant to section 108 of the Act (rules: appointment of curators ad litem and reporting officers) for the purpose of the discharge of their duties in that behalf.
